Immunocytochemistry/ Immunofluorescence - Anti-SARS CoV 2 (COVID 19) Membrane antibody [HL1088] (AB308415)
For immunofluorescence analysis, HEK293T cells were fixed in 4% paraformaldehyde at room temperature for 15 minutes and permeabilized for detection of SARS CoV 2 (COVID 19) Membrane using ab308415 at 1/2000 dilution (green). Blue : Fluoroshield with DAPI.

Biological function summary
The SARS-CoV-2 membrane protein plays a significant role in the viral infection process. It functions to orchestrate the assembly of new virions by localizing at the endoplasmic reticulum-Golgi intermediate compartment (ERGIC). The M protein often interacts with the nucleocapsid (N) protein forming a complex essential for packaging viral RNA. This partnership ensures the virus efficiently assembles and buds from the host cell aiding in the sufficient production of infectious particles.
Pathways
The SARS-CoV-2 M protein stands central in viral pathogenesis. It participates in the formation of the viral replication complex within the host cell. The protein interacts with the spike (S) protein facilitating viral entry into the host by enabling the fusion of the viral and cellular membranes through its role in the ERGIC. Additionally the M protein is involved in pathways related to modulating host immune responses often dampening interferon signaling which is important for the host's initial defense against viral infections.
